1-800-FLOWERS.COM (NASDAQ:FLWS – Get Free Report)‘s stock had its “neutral” rating reaffirmed by stock analysts at DA Davidson in a research report issued on Friday,Benzinga reports. They currently have a $7.50 price objective on the specialty retailer’s stock. DA Davidson’s price objective would suggest a potential upside of 28.42% from the company’s current price.
Separately, Weiss Ratings restated a “sell (d-)” rating on shares of 1-800-FLOWERS.COM in a report on Friday, March 7th.

1-800-FLOWERS.COM Stock Performance
1-800-FLOWERS.COM (NASDAQ:FLWS – Get Free Report) last released its quarterly earnings results on Thursday, January 30th. The specialty retailer reported $1.08 earnings per share (EPS) for the quarter, missing the consensus estimate of $1.19 by ($0.11). 1-800-FLOWERS.COM had a negative net margin of 0.43% and a negative return on equity of 0.76%. Equities analysts expect that 1-800-FLOWERS.COM will post -0.07 EPS for the current fiscal year.

About 1-800-FLOWERS.COM
1-800-FLOWERS.COM, Inc provides gifts for various occasions in the United States and internationally. It operates through three segments: Consumer Floral & Gifts, Gourmet Foods & Gift Baskets, and BloomNet. The company offers a range of products, including fresh-cut flowers, floral and fruit arrangements, plants, gifts, personalized products, dipped berries, popcorns, gourmet foods and gift baskets, cookies, chocolates, candies, wines, and gift-quality fruits.
